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Artificial Intelligence and Atmospheric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 11 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 11 papers in Atmospheric Science. Recurrent topics in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os’s work include Solar Radiation and Photovoltaics (11 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(8 papers) and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(7 papers).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os is often cited by papers focused on Solar Radiation and Photovoltaics (11 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(8 papers) and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(7 papers).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os collaborates with scholars based in Spain, Greece and United States. Francisco J. Santos‐Alamillos's co-authors include David Pozo‐Vázquez, José A. Ruiz‐Arias, J. Tovar‐Pescador, Vicente Lara-Fanego, Nikolaos S. Thomaidis, Julio Usaola, Christian A. Gueymard, Lueder von Bremen, Clara Arbizu‐Barrena and Jimy Dudhia and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Journal of Cleaner Production and Geophysical Research Letters.
